About The Global Library of Women's Medicine
The Global Library of Women’s Medicine is published on a not-for-profit basis by The Foundation for The Global Library of Women’s Medicine. Its sole purpose is to offer a minor contribution to the enhancement of women’s healthcare around the world. It was founded, launched, and initially funded by David and Paula Bloomer in memory of their daughter, Abigail. The site now also receives a small number of grants and donations for which we are most grateful, and which have enabled the programme to continue and grow. It is particularly important to emphasise that the site has been supported from the outset by all of its very many expert editors and authors who have most generously provided all their contributions without any fee or other remuneration; without their greatly appreciated and selfless support this whole educational initiative would not have been possible. Our Objectives: The objective of this site is to provide medical professionals worldwide with expert, peer reviewed, guidance on best practice for women’s medicine in the hope that this will contribute, albeit in a modest way, to better healthcare for women. Safer motherhood – The site has a special focus on Safer Motherhood – offering a vast range of resources to support doctors, midwives and even community healthcare workers. Less-resourced countries – Whilst relevant everywhere, the site is designed to be of special additional value to less-resourced countries, where access to the latest information may not always be easily available. Free Access to the site is entirely free – it contains no advertising and has no commercial objectives. It has been funded by private donations, some unrestricted educational grants and by over 800 authors who have generously provided their contributions entirely free and without any kind of remuneration
